Xaghra Parish » Gallery » 2009 » CARNIVAL 2009 » 20 FEB 09 - FIRST DAY OF CARNIVAL IN XAGHRA - DANCES » A8 Young revellers in Victory Square

A8 Young revellers in Victory Square
Not yet rated